Al-Thuqaibah, a sprawling Iron Age II settlement that thrived between 1000 and 600 BCE, is situated just south of Dhaid at the southern tip of Al Madam oasis in central Sharjah Emirate, United Arab Emirates. Over three decades, archaeological teams from Sharjah, France, and Spain have thoroughly investigated this site, unearthing mud-brick houses, lush gardens, and compelling evidence of mud-brick production. Hundreds of remarkably preserved footprints remain hidden at the bottom of numerous small basins, their impressions frozen in time like a snapshot of the past. Recent advances in technology allowed GDH to meticulously scan and document these basins and their contents using high-resolution scanning and photogrammetry. The results are evident in basin 16, skillfully processed from an impressive 253 images captured by Reality Capture software.
